Output 2f63c51b14aa8668e8bb27cd4abf554a07e04098fd0ca8c75bf44db32c95dfcf:0

value
51259675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003aa1965145234f7af3d3b0a6746e191d58ad0f OP_EQUAL
address
31iEAJzG7AMEFrDVpfDKWG1qTbLLsUgLAa
transaction
2f63c51b14aa8668e8bb27cd4abf554a07e04098fd0ca8c75bf44db32c95dfcf
spent
true